About Kalamunda 6076

The size of Kalamunda is approximately 10.6 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 23.9% of total area. The population of Kalamunda in 2011 was 6,636 people. By 2016 the population was 6,982 showing a population growth of 5.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kalamunda is 60-69 years. Households in Kalamunda are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kalamunda work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 81.1% of the homes in Kalamunda were owner-occupied compared with 82.3% in 2016.
